How about this. This is the largest Lexus forum on the planet. Why don't you find us one instance, one time when Lexus denied a warranty claim because the owner had their service done either by another shop or themselves. If this were happening; it would be here.
Even in the case of the 3.0L engine gelling when they extended the warranty because of seized engines due to lack of oil changes, they did not try and deny claims because the oil was changed elsewhere than the dealer. In fact, formally they wanted to see one oil change per year, regardless of mileage and didn't deny claims even if they couldn't get evidence of that.
If you're going to do your own maintenance keep logs, keep receipts for the oil, Etc. I use the dealer sometimes, sometimes not. When I don't use the dealer I enter the service I did in the online Lexus owners portal, and scan and save my receipts. If there's ever an issue, it won't be an issue.
FYI the reason I don't use the dealer is partly due to cost but also due to the fact that every time they get my car they screw it up in some way. They scratch a console by carelessly dropping the key on it, they scratch a wheel, they screw it up washing it even though I tell them not to. They scuff the dash by throwing all their paperwork up there. My independent doesn't do any of that, he does a better job and it's cheaper. Hard to argue with that.
I would pay more if I got more. But, what you get is all window dressing.
